Plot.
After escaping from the raid of giant monster Skull Gomora, Riku Asakura and his partner Pega stumbled upon a secret base lied 500 m underground. Given the Geed Riser and Ultra Capsules by operating system Rem, he transforms into Ultraman Geed and becomes a hero that his childhood inspired.

Wiki.
Ultraman Geed (γ¦γ«γγ©γγ³γΈγΌγ, Urutoraman JΔ«do) is a Japanese tokusatsu drama produced by Tsuburaya Productions and the 22nd entry (31st overall) to the Ultra Series. It aired on TV Tokyo from July 8, 2017, to December 23, 2017. The series is simulcast outside Japan by Crunchyroll.
The main catchphrase is "Fate β prepare for it." (ιε½ β θ¦ζγζ±Ίγγγ, Unmei β kakugo o kimero.).
